<p><a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/category/samsung/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">Samsung</a> has launched the beta version of <em>Samsung Internet for PC</em>, expanding its mobile browser to desktop. The new version aims to give users a smooth, connected browsing experience across all Samsung devices. It is also a step toward making Samsung Internet a central part of the company’s growing Galaxy AI ecosystem.</p>



<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="aligncenter size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="683"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/001-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-1024x683.jpg?x10805" alt="" class="wp-image-713240"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/001-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-1024x683.jpg 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/001-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-300x200.jpg 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/001-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-768x512.jpg 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/001-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-696x464.jpg 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/001-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-1068x712.jpg 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/001-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-630x420.jpg 630w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/001-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ody.jpg 1440w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ure></div>



<p>Won-Joon Choi, Chief Operating Officer of Samsung’s Mobile eXperience Business, said, “As we expand Samsung Internet to PC, we’re excited to invite users to shape the future of browsing with us.” He added that the new beta brings mobile and PC closer together while setting up future updates focused on smarter, AI-powered browsing.</p>



<h3>Seamless Connection Between Mobile and PC</h3>



<p>Samsung Internet for PC lets users sync bookmarks, browsing history, and Samsung Pass data. This makes it easy to log in to websites or autofill information securely on any device. Users can also pick up right where they left off when switching between their phone and PC, creating a consistent experience across platforms.</p>



<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="aligncenter size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="538"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/002-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-1024x538.jpg?x10805" alt="" class="wp-image-713239"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/002-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-1024x538.jpg 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/002-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-300x158.jpg 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/002-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-768x404.jpg 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/002-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-696x366.jpg 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/002-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-1068x561.jpg 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/002-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ody-799x420.jpg 799w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/002-Samsung-Internet-Expands-to-PC-With-New-Beta-Program-Newsbody.jpg 1440w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ure></div>



<p>When logged into a Samsung Account, users can access Galaxy AI features such as <em>Browsing Assist</em>, which provides quick webpage summaries and translations. These tools are designed to save time and help users find information faster.</p>



<h3>Built-In Security and Privacy</h3>



<p>The browser is built with Samsung’s standard privacy and security framework. Smart Anti-Tracking blocks third-party trackers that try to collect personal information, while the <em>Privacy Dashboard</em> shows and manages privacy settings in real time.</p>



<h3>Availability</h3>



<p>The Samsung Internet for PC beta is available starting October 30, 2025, for Windows 11 and Windows 10 (version 1809 or higher) users in the United States and Korea. More regions will be added later.</p>

<p><a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/openai/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">OpenAI</a> has launched ChatGPT Atlas, a new AI-powered browser that integrates its popular chatbot directly into the browsing experience. The company made the browser available on macOS this week, with support for Windows, iOS, and Android expected soon. Atlas is free to download and supports all ChatGPT account tiers, including Free, Plus, Pro, Business, and Enterprise.</p>



<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="aligncenter size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="640"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1024x640.png?x10805" alt="ChatGPT Atlas" class="wp-image-712299"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1024x640.png 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-300x188.png 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-768x480.png 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-696x435.png 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1068x668.png 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-672x420.png 672w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as.png 1200w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ure></div>



<p>ChatGPT Atlas replaces the traditional address bar with a chat-based interface, allowing direct interaction with AI features across any webpage. It eliminates the need to switch tabs or copy text, providing assistance in real time. The built-in sidebar enables ChatGPT to summarize articles, answer queries, and assist in completing tasks using the live content of the page.</p>



<p>OpenAI also introduces Agent Mode, a premium feature for Plus and Business subscribers. It enables ChatGPT to handle multi-step actions like online shopping, topic research, and automating routine workflows. It supports contextual assistance, allowing users to highlight text in emails, documents, or invites and receive help directly within the same tab.</p>



<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="aligncenter size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="685"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-1024x685.webp?x10805" alt="ChatGPT Atlas" class="wp-image-712298"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-1024x685.webp 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-300x201.webp 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-768x513.webp 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-1536x1027.webp 1536w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-2048x1369.webp 2048w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-696x465.webp 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-1068x714.webp 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-1920x1283.webp 1920w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2025/10/ChatGPT-Atlas-1-628x420.webp 628w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ure></div>



<p>The browser includes memory features that let ChatGPT retain browsing context, allowing it to resume tasks such as job searches, list creation, or content summarization. It also offers privacy controls that enable users to disable memory, switch to incognito mode, and limit visibility on specific websites.</p>



<p>Atlas allows data import from Google Chrome, including bookmarks, passwords, and browsing history. It can be set as the default browser through the settings menu, and new users receive higher rate limits during the first week.</p>



<p>OpenAI said the browser is part of its broader effort to reshape how users interact with the web. The launch comes amid growing competition from <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/category/google/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">Google’</a>s Gemini-powered Chrome and other AI-first browsers like Perplexity’s Comet.</p>



<p>According to OpenAI, ChatGPT now serves over 800 million weekly active users. The company aims to expand that number further by integrating AI tools directly into core digital workflows.</p>

<p>The wait is over for <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/windows-11">Windows 11</a> users! After months in beta, The <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/browser">Browser</a> Company has finally launched the official version of Arc browser 1.0.1. Users can now download and use Arc directly without needing to join a waiting list.</p>



<h3>Windows 10 users may have to wait longer for their turn to try the browser out.</h3>



<p>However, there&#8217;s a catch: Arc currently only supports Windows 11. Those on <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/windows-10">Windows 10 </a>will need to wait a bit longer for their turn. There&#8217;s also good news for users with ARM-based Windows machines, as a native ARM64 version of Arc is planned for a future release. Interestingly, the Windows version of Arc leverages Apple&#8217;s Swift programming language, similar to the macOS version. This allows the browser to share some core code with its <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/mac">Mac</a> counterpart.</p>



<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="aligncenter size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="849"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/04/Arc_browser_logo.svg_-1024x849.png?x10805" alt="" class="wp-image-622280"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/04/Arc_browser_logo.svg_-1024x849.png 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/04/Arc_browser_logo.svg_-300x249.png 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/04/Arc_browser_logo.svg_-768x637.png 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/04/Arc_browser_logo.svg_-696x577.png 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/04/Arc_browser_logo.svg_-1068x886.png 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/04/Arc_browser_logo.svg_-507x420.png 507w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/04/Arc_browser_logo.svg_.png 1200w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ure></div>



<p>Arc has a unique interface with a sidebar that houses features like tabs, library, easels &amp; notes, spaces, boosts, and archived tabs. It also has some innovative features like the ability to rename tabs, peek into links before opening them, and take notes within the browser.</p>



<p>However, Arc also has some hard edges. It has a steep learning curve due to its new design and reliance on keyboard shortcuts. Overall, it is a promising new browser with some innovative features, but some may argue that it is not ready for mass adoption yet. Well, with a whole new user base, we&#8217;ll find out soon what people think about the Browser.</p>

<p>Google has announced that it will soon begin phasing out support for third-party cookies in its <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/guides/how-to-turn-off-chrome-browsers-new-download-tray/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">Chrome web browser</a>. But let&#8217;s start from the beginning, what are cookies? Cookies are small text files that allow websites to identify and track users. Third-party cookies are not created by the website you are visiting, but rather by another website when you visit that particular site. </p>



<figure class="wp-block-image size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="465"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/Screenshot-2021-03-01-at-10.28.10-AM-1024x465.png?x10805" alt="Google Chrome" class="wp-image-373859"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/Screenshot-2021-03-01-at-10.28.10-AM-1024x465.png 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/Screenshot-2021-03-01-at-10.28.10-AM-300x136.png 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/Screenshot-2021-03-01-at-10.28.10-AM-768x349.png 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/Screenshot-2021-03-01-at-10.28.10-AM-696x316.png 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/Screenshot-2021-03-01-at-10.28.10-AM-1068x485.png 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/Screenshot-2021-03-01-at-10.28.10-AM-925x420.png 925w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/Screenshot-2021-03-01-at-10.28.10-AM.png 1660w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ure>



<p>These cookies are commonly used by advertisers to track users&#8217; online activities. Google removing these cookies can help reduce the tracking of users&#8217; online activities. This may result in users being less targeted with ads and could help them maintain online privacy. Actually, this is not something new. Google had announced a long time ago that it would phase out third-party cookies. However, the exact date for this move was not specified. </p>



<p>Now, the company has revealed in a recent statement that they will commence the process in January 2024. But don&#8217;t panic. What will happen if a website relies on cookies and needs them to function properly? If Chrome is convinced that a site won&#8217;t open without cookies and you&#8217;re experiencing issues, it will allow you to re-enable cookies for that site. However, you may need to perform actions like refreshing the page multiple times for the system to detect this. </p>



<p>You don&#8217;t need to worry either. Because Google will initially apply this policy to only 1% of Chrome users. Therefore, we most likely won&#8217;t be in the affected group. However, the goal is to completely block third-party cookies for all users by the second half of 2024. It&#8217;s worth noting that Google Chrome is not the first browser developer to restrict third-party cookies. Competitors like Safari, Firefox, and Brave have been blocking trackers in this way for a long time, making them among the safest browsers you can use.</p>

<p>Safari is a web browser developed by Apple Inc. and is designed specifically for use on Apple devices such as Macs, <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/iphone">iPhones</a>, and <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/ipad">iPads</a>. It is known for its sleek and intuitive interface, fast performance, and seamless integration with Apple&#8217;s ecosystem. Safari offers a range of features including a robust privacy and security system, intelligent tracking prevention, and built-in support for Apple&#8217;s iCloud Keychain for password management. The browser also supports various extensions, allowing users to customize their browsing experience further. Safari is widely regarded for its efficient power management, making it an excellent choice for Apple device users who value both speed and energy efficiency.</p>



<h3>New Safari seems to blur the line between desktop and web apps</h3>



<p>While Safari may not always steal the spotlight in <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/macos">macOS</a>, Apple continues to invest in its web browser, unveiling the latest version with a host of notable enhancements. From improved privacy controls and encryption features to the innovative creation of web apps, Safari is set to redefine the browsing experience.</p>



<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="aligncenter size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="690"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/06/rubaitul-azad-q-STPNMV6KU-unsplash-1024x690.jpg?x10805" alt="Safari" class="wp-image-542096" /></figure></div>



<p>One of the most exciting features is the introduction of web apps. Similar to <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/google-chrome">Google Chrome</a>&#8216;s shortcuts, Safari allows users to place websites directly in the dock, just like any other app. Upon opening, these web apps present a minimalist interface, concealing the fact that users are interacting with a browser. By blurring the line between desktop and web apps, Safari aligns itself with Chrome&#8217;s ambition, particularly as <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/chromeOS">Chrome OS</a> gained momentum.</p>



<p>The significance of Safari&#8217;s improvements, however, lies in privacy. Not only on macOS but also on iOS 17 and iPadOS 17, private browsing now offers heightened protection against trackers and prevents sites from identifying users through their <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/fingerprints">fingerprints</a>. Additionally, private browsing sessions can be locked with a fingerprint, providing peace of mind when stepping away from the computer during sensitive activities like gift shopping.</p>



<p>Profiles are another noteworthy addition, available on both macOS and iPadOS. Users can organize their browsing by topic or context, segregating work-related tabs in a separate Safari window with dedicated cookies, extensions, and favorites. Furthermore, Safari enables the secure sharing of passwords or password groups through iCloud Keychain, utilizing end-to-end encryption. This feature not only streamlines password management but also reinforces the browser&#8217;s commitment to user privacy. </p>



<p>The latest iteration of Safari will be part of the upcoming macOS Sonoma, slated for release later this year. The beta version is set to launch next month, accompanied by the arrival of iPadOS 17 and <a href="http://gizmochina.com/tag/ios-17">iOS 17</a>. <p>Google Chrome continues to be the undisputed leader in the <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/2023/05/01/microsoft-edge-popular-desktop-browser/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">browser market</a>. According to recent research, the company holds a 66.13% market share, far ahead of its closest competitor, Safari, with an 11.87% share. However, as in every industry, competition here benefits users and prevents leading names from becoming complacent. As a result, all browsers, including Chrome, regularly update with new features and performance improvements for users. For instance, Google recently announced the release of Chrome 113, a major update for its popular web browser. This update introduces faster AV1 video encoding for video conference calls, WebGPU by default, and various other improvements. Here are the details&#8230;</p>



<h2><strong>Chrome 113 Revolutionizes Browsing with New Features</strong></h2>



<p>Google has announced the release of <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/2023/04/25/google-chrome-web-app-play-store-like-installation-design/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">Chrome</a> 113, which offers faster AV1 video encoding for video conference calls, WebGPU by default, and various other improvements. The new update is now accessible on Linux, macOS, and Windows platforms, including 15 additional security fixes. Some of these improvements are as follows:</p>



<figure class="wp-block-image size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="576"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/google-unveils-chrome-113-1024x576.png?x10805" alt="" class="wp-image-534450"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/google-unveils-chrome-113-1024x576.png 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/google-unveils-chrome-113-300x169.png 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/google-unveils-chrome-113-768x432.png 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/google-unveils-chrome-113-696x392.png 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/google-unveils-chrome-113-1068x601.png 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/google-unveils-chrome-113-747x420.png 747w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/google-unveils-chrome-113.png 1280w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ure>



<ul><li>Faster AV1 Video Encoding<ul><li>Chrome 113 has integrated the libaom 3.6 release, which significantly speeds up CPU-based AV1 video encoding. This update will benefit all WebRTC apps, enabling faster and more efficient video conference calls. Google Meet has already tested AV1 video quality down to 40 kbps, showing its potential for use even in low bandwidth situations.</li></ul></li><li>CSS Media Features<ul><li>This release introduces the CSS overflow-inline and overflow-block media features, as well as an update to the CSS media feature.</li></ul></li><li>Linear Easing Function<ul><li>Chrome 113 adds a linear() easing function, allowing for linear interpolation between multiple points.</li></ul></li><li>Support for CSS image-set()<ul><li>The browser now supports CSS image-set() as a type for specifying a range of image options.</li></ul></li><li>WebGPU Enabled by Default<ul><li>WebGPU, the successor to WebGL, is now enabled by default in Chrome 113. This offers improved performance for high-quality 3D graphics in the web, making it an exciting development for gamers and other users who rely on advanced graphics.</li></ul></li></ul>



<p>With the release of Chrome 113, users can expect faster and more efficient video conference calls, better support for CSS media features, and improved 3D graphics performance with WebGPU enabled by default.</p>

<h2><strong>Microsoft is forcing Outlook and Teams to open links in Edge</strong></h2>



<p>Introduced in 2015, Microsoft Edge brought an end to the 20-year reign of Internet Explorer and has undoubtedly become one of the best browsers in the market. However, it has been unable to achieve the success it deserves. Many first-time Windows users still download Google Chrome as their first task. In fact, a recent report revealed that <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/2023/05/01/microsoft-edge-popular-desktop-browser/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">Microsoft Edge</a> is in worse shape than we thought, losing its second place in the computer browser market to Safari. </p>



<figure class="wp-block-image size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="576"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/microsoft-forcing-outlook-teams-open-links-edge-1024x576.jpeg?x10805" alt="" class="wp-image-534417"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/microsoft-forcing-outlook-teams-open-links-edge-1024x576.jpeg 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/microsoft-forcing-outlook-teams-open-links-edge-300x169.jpeg 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/microsoft-forcing-outlook-teams-open-links-edge-768x432.jpeg 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/microsoft-forcing-outlook-teams-open-links-edge-696x392.jpeg 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/microsoft-forcing-outlook-teams-open-links-edge-1068x601.jpeg 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/microsoft-forcing-outlook-teams-open-links-edge-746x420.jpeg 746w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/microsoft-forcing-outlook-teams-open-links-edge.jpeg 1500w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ure>



<p>In response to these developments, Microsoft has taken some &#8220;unpleasant&#8221; measures to change the course. According to notifications sent to IT admins through the Microsoft 365 admin center, Outlook and Teams will no longer use your default browser to open clicked links. Instead, they will force users to use Microsoft Edge. This won&#8217;t change your default browser settings, and you can continue to use alternatives like Google Chrome for everything else. </p>



<p>However, as part of the Windows operating system, these two essential applications will take away your customizable settings and push you to use Microsoft Edge. Users quickly reacted to this development, and Microsoft has defended the move, stating that it aims to simplify the user experience and reduce task switching between windows and tabs. Still, this weak defense has failed to satisfy anyone. The company may need to reconsider its approach if it wants to win over users and maintain a positive image.</p>

<p><a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/microsoft/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">Microsoft </a>has just released a new limited public preview of its <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/microsoft-edge/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">Edge </a>Workspace feature. The new Edge browser will basically let you share a bunch of browser tabs simultaneously with a single link.</p>



<p>The new Microsoft Edge Workspace feature will allow users to be able to save and share a set of browser tabs using a single link. This will not only lower the time required to share individual links, but it helps in sharing a bunch of these tabs together. One can even save a bunch of tabs that are related to the same topic and label them within the Edge browser. To put things simply, users can now save groups of tabs like how they bookmark a single one in the past. </p>



<div class="wp-block-image"><figure class="aligncenter size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="582"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/04/microsoft-edge-workspace-feature-image-1024x582.webp?x10805" alt="Microsoft" class="wp-image-527954"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/04/microsoft-edge-workspace-feature-image-1024x582.webp 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/04/microsoft-edge-workspace-feature-image-300x171.webp 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/04/microsoft-edge-workspace-feature-image-768x436.webp 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/04/microsoft-edge-workspace-feature-image-696x396.webp 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/04/microsoft-edge-workspace-feature-image-1068x607.webp 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/04/microsoft-edge-workspace-feature-image-739x420.webp 739w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/04/microsoft-edge-workspace-feature-image.webp 1485w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ure></div>



<p>Interestingly enough, this is quite similar to Microsoft Edge&#8217;s existing &#8216;Collections&#8217; feature that lets you save and organize websites. So, the new Edge Workspace features brings additional functionality with the ability of saving and sharing groups of tabs between your own devices, or to your friends. Furthermore, it will even let the other parties add or edit the tabs in real time.</p>



<p>The new Edge Workspace feature can be found on the top left corner of the browser. Clicking on this will have you see an option to create and name the new Workspace. These tabs can be shared by simply clicking on the &#8216;Invite&#8217; button to the right of the Edge&#8217;s address bar and then copy the link. </p>

<h2><strong>Microsoft Edge 110 has a built-in VPN</strong></h2>



<p>Microsoft has been testing a version of its <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/Microsoft-Edge/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">Edge</a> with a built-in VPN service for about a year. Now, the company has rolled out the feature to some users in the latest stable version. The new feature, called Secure Network, has been implemented in partnership with Cloudflare and provides users with 1GB of secure VPN traffic as part of the free plan. The fact that the feature has reached the final stages of implementation suggests that Microsoft is likely to announce pricing and a full release of the Edge Secure Network soon.</p>



<figure class="wp-block-image size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="576"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-1024x576.jpeg?x10805" alt="Microsoft Edge" class="wp-image-517129"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-1024x576.jpeg 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-300x169.jpeg 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-768x432.jpeg 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-696x392.jpeg 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-1068x601.jpeg 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-747x420.jpeg 747w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et.jpeg 1280w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ure>



<p>The Secure Network VPN feature emphasizes the privacy benefits of using a VPN rather than its ability to circumvent regional restrictions by changing the user&#8217;s IP address. The service automatically selects servers in the user’s region for safe operation on public networks. In other words, users can only use the Secure Network to protect their privacy.</p>



<p>According to screenshots of Edge 110, which have appeared online, the VPN service supports three modes of operation: &#8220;Selected Sites,&#8221; &#8220;Optimized,&#8221; and &#8220;All Sites.&#8221; This suggests that users will have the option to choose which sites they want to protect with the VPN, or to turn it on for all sites. It&#8217;s worth noting that Google added a free VPN to its Pixel 7 series smartphones late last year. However, Microsoft&#8217;s decision to integrate a VPN directly into its web browser is a significant step that could lead to increased use of VPNs among its users.</p>



<figure class="wp-block-image size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="576"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-2-1024x576.jpeg?x10805" alt="Microsoft Edge " class="wp-image-517131"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-2-1024x576.jpeg 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-2-300x169.jpeg 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-2-768x432.jpeg 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-2-696x392.jpeg 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-2-1068x601.jpeg 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-2-747x420.jpeg 747w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/02/microsoft-edge-110-has-a-built-in-vpn-but-not-for-everyone-yet-2.jpeg 1280w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ure>



<p>The integration of a VPN service into a major web browser marks a significant step forward for online privacy and security. But it&#8217;s not likely to become the industry standard until Google starts using it.</p>

<h3>New Google Chrome features to save battery and make browsing smoother</h3>



<p>Google has announced that it will be optimizing its Chrome web browser for battery and system memory. The company will be rolling out new performance settings that will reduce Chrome&#8217;s memory usage by up to 40% to improve the stability of open tabs. The new modes, called Memory Saver and Energy Saver, will be available globally for Windows, macOS, and ChromeOS in the coming weeks.</p>



<figure class="wp-block-image size-large"><img loading="lazy" width="1024" height="576"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/12/google-chrome-will-now-consume-much-less-ram-and-energy-1-1024x576.jpg?x10805" alt="" class="wp-image-501121"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/12/google-chrome-will-now-consume-much-less-ram-and-energy-1-1024x576.jpg 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/12/google-chrome-will-now-consume-much-less-ram-and-energy-1-300x169.jpg 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/12/google-chrome-will-now-consume-much-less-ram-and-energy-1-768x432.jpg 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/12/google-chrome-will-now-consume-much-less-ram-and-energy-1-696x392.jpg 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/12/google-chrome-will-now-consume-much-less-ram-and-energy-1-1068x601.jpg 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/12/google-chrome-will-now-consume-much-less-ram-and-energy-1-747x420.jpg 747w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/12/google-chrome-will-now-consume-much-less-ram-and-energy-1.jpg 1280w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></figure>



<p>Memory Saver mode is designed to help users who have many tabs open at the same time. It will reduce the memory usage of each tab, allowing users to keep more tabs open without causing their device to slow down. Memory Saver mode frees up memory from tabs you aren’t currently using so the active websites you’re browsing have the smoothest possible experience. This is especially useful if you’re running other intensive applications, like editing family videos or playing games. Any inactive tabs will be reloaded when you need them.</p>



<p>Energy Saver mode is designed to help users extend their device&#8217;s battery life while using Chrome. It will automatically activate when a user&#8217;s device battery level drops to 20%, and it will reduce energy consumption by limiting background activity and visual effects for websites with animations and videos. This can be particularly useful for users who rely on their devices for long periods of time without access to a power source.</p>



<p>These new modes are part of Google&#8217;s ongoing efforts to improve the performance and efficiency of Chrome. The company has also recently introduced other features, such as tab grouping and tab search, to help users manage their open tabs more efficiently. With the addition of Memory Saver and Energy Saver modes, Chrome users will have even more control over how the browser uses their device&#8217;s resources. You can find these controls under the three-dot menu in Chrome.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<img width="300" height="169"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348-300x169.png?x10805" class="webfeedsFeaturedVisual wp-post-image" alt="Vivaldi for Android smartphones" loading="lazy" style="display: block; margin: auto; margin-bottom: 5px;max-width: 100%;" link_thumbnail=""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348-300x169.png 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348-768x432.png 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348-696x392.png 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348-746x420.png 746w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348.png 938w" sizes="(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px" /><p>Vivaldi, the Chromium-based web browser has introduced two rows of tabs to its Android mobile browser, making it the first browser to do so on the smartphone platform.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" class="size-full wp-image-428993 aligncenter"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348.png?x10805" alt="Vivaldi for Android smartphones" width="938" height="528"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348.png 938w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348-300x169.png 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348-768x432.png 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348-696x392.png 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230348-746x420.png 746w" sizes="(max-width: 938px) 100vw, 938px" /></p>
<p>The new feature comes with its 5.0 update and enables users to keep two separate rows of tabs open at once, placing one on top of the other row. The &#8220;two-level tab stacks&#8221; solution was launched earlier this year in the browser&#8217;s desktop version and now has come to Android devices. Yes, that includes Android tablets, which get a whole host of improvements and new features, but more on that later.</p>
<h4>Vivaldi 5.0 for Android smartphones</h4>
<p>To enable this new feature, you have to long-press the New Tab button and select &#8220;New Tab Stack.&#8221; That should allow you to start using the new stack/group you created, with the current tab and one new additional tab.</p>
<p>In addition to the two-level tab stack feature, the 5.0 update also brings an improved tab interface and new ways to tweak the tab bar. The built-in Notes tool has been enhanced too so that users can quickly handle big chunks of text from a webpage to an existing note with an &#8220;Append to Note&#8221; option when highlighting text. Lastly, the update also brings dark mode for websites. When you toggle this feature, the browser automatically changes the site background color to black, making it easier on the eyes. This setting is saved on a per-site basis.</p>
<h4>Vivaldi for Android tablets</h4>
<p><img loading="lazy" class="size-full wp-image-428995 aligncenter"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230553.png?x10805" alt="Vivaldi for Android tablets" width="936" height="526"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230553.png 936w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230553-300x169.png 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230553-768x432.png 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230553-696x391.png 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/12/Screenshot-2021-12-03-230553-747x420.png 747w" sizes="(max-width: 936px) 100vw, 936px" /></p>
<p>Vivaldi 5.0 also improves support for Android tablets. The tablet platform also gets the &#8220;two-level tab stacks&#8221; feature with an additional way of creating a new stack by simply dragging tabs onto one another to create a new tab stack.</p>
<p>Like the desktop browser, tablet users can now enable panels that appear on the left and provide quick access to functions such as bookmarks, history, notes, etc.</p>
<p>For those unaware, Vivaldi is a freeware, cross-platform web browser developed by Vivaldi Technologies, a Norway-based company founded by Tatsuki Tomita and Jon Stephenson von Tetzchner, who was the co-founder and CEO of Opera Software.</p>
<p>Although intended for general users, it is first and foremost targeted towards technically-inclined users as well as former Opera users disgruntled by its transition from the Presto layout engine to a Chromium-based browser that resulted in the loss of many of its iconic features.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<img width="300" height="189"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/Windows-11-featured-new-300x189.jpg?x10805" class="webfeedsFeaturedVisual wp-post-image" alt="Windows 11 featured new" loading="lazy" style="display: block; margin: auto; margin-bottom: 5px;max-width: 100%;" link_thumbnail=""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/Windows-11-featured-new-300x189.jpg 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/Windows-11-featured-new-666x420.jpg 666w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/Windows-11-featured-new.jpg 690w" sizes="(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px" /><p>Back in August, we had reported on <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/2021/08/19/microsoft-harder-to-switch-browser-windows-11/"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Microsoft making it harder for users to switch the default browser</a> in its latest version of Windows OS. But now, it seems that <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/mozilla/"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Mozilla</a> has managed to beat this hurdle on <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/windows-11/"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Windows 11</a> for its <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/mozilla-firefox/"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Firefox</a> browser.</p>
<p><figure id="attachment_412358" aria-describedby="caption-attachment-412358" style="width: 800px" class="wp-caption aligncenter"><img loading="lazy" class="wp-image-412358 size-full"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/firefoxdefaults.gif?x10805" alt="Mozilla" width="800" height="450" /><figcaption id="caption-attachment-412358" class="wp-caption-text">Via The Verge</figcaption></figure></p>
<p>For those unaware, the American tech giant had basically made it a one click process to set Edge as the default browser. However, browsers from other firms had to go through a complicated tasks, which would&#8217;ve been quite an annoying task for many users. Although, Mozilla has quietly managed to defeat this with its version 91 of Firefox. The company achieved this by reverse engineering the way Microsoft sets Edge as the default browser in Windows 10.</p>
<p>This enabled it to set Firefox as a default browser quicker. Prior to this, one would have to go to Windows 10&#8217;s settings to select Firefox as the default browser, all the while Microsoft would ask you to consider Edge. Furthermore, the reverse engineering also meant that you can even set the default browser from with Firefox itself without requiring any additional prompts. But keep in mind that this circumvents the Microsoft anti hijacking protections that is built into Windows 10 to prevent malware from hijacking default apps.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" class="aligncenter wp-image-407253 size-full"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/nBhaqDv.jpg?x10805" alt="Mozilla" width="1400" height="788"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/nBhaqDv.jpg 1400w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/nBhaqDv-300x169.jpg 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/nBhaqDv-768x432.jpg 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/nBhaqDv-1024x576.jpg 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/nBhaqDv-696x392.jpg 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/nBhaqDv-1068x601.jpg 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/nBhaqDv-746x420.jpg 746w" sizes="(max-width: 1400px) 100vw, 1400px" /></p>
<p>A Mozilla spokesperson stated that &#8220;People should have the ability to simply and easily set defaults, but they don’t. All operating systems should offer official developer support for default status so people can easily set their apps as default. Since that hasn’t happened on Windows 10 and 11, Firefox relies on other aspects of the Windows environment to give people an experience similar to what Windows provides to Edge when users choose Firefox to be their default browser.&#8221;</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<img width="300" height="125"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-300x125.png?x10805" class="webfeedsFeaturedVisual wp-post-image" alt="" loading="lazy" style="display: block; margin: auto; margin-bottom: 5px;max-width: 100%;" link_thumbnail=""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-300x125.png 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-768x320.png 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-1024x426.png 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-696x290.png 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-1068x445.png 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-1009x420.png 1009w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-1920x800.png 1920w" sizes="(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px" /><p>Google <a href="https://security.googleblog.com/2020/10/new-password-protections-and-more-in.html">has revealed</a> several security-related features coming in Chrome 86, enhancing the security and usefulness of the Chrome mobile app. One of the highlights includes improved password security for Android as well as iOS application.</p>
<p>The feature has the capability of spotting compromised passwords within the list of saved passwords on <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/chrome">Chrome</a>, and then offer users advice on how to fix them. It will crosscheck saved credentials against a list of credentials that are known to be compromised.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" class="size-full wp-image-346518 aligncenter" src="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features.png?x10805" alt="Google Chrome Security Features" width="2747" height="1144" srcset="https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features.png 2747w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-300x125.png 300w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-768x320.png 768w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-1024x426.png 1024w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-696x290.png 696w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-1068x445.png 1068w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-1009x420.png 1009w, https://www.gizmochina.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/10/Google-Chrome-Security-Features-1920x800.png 1920w" sizes="(max-width: 2747px) 100vw, 2747px" /></p>
<p>For those who are concerned about privacy and <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/security">security</a>, the company says that usernames and passwords are sent to the company in a special form of encryption so that the company cannot get hold of the data.</p>
<p>If Chrome spots a compromised password, it will offer users an option to directly go to the &#8220;change password&#8221; form of the associated service or platform.</p>
<p style="text-align: center"><strong><span style="color: #ff0000">EDITOR&#8217;S PICK:</span> </strong><a title="Instagram expands shopping service support to IGTV and Reels" href="https://www.gizmochina.com/2020/10/07/instagram-igtv-reels-shopping/" rel="bookmark"><strong>Instagram expands shopping service support to IGTV and Reels</strong></a></p>
<p>Another feature is Safety Check, which enables the manual check of compromised passwords, the status of Safe Browsing mode, and the version of the current Chrome app with details about the latest security protections.</p>
<p>For those who are using Chrome on <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/ios">iOS</a> devices, it will now allow users to autofill saved login credentials into other apps and browsers. Users can also enable biometric authentication prompt before Chrome fills passwords, as an improved security feature.</p>
<p><a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/google">Google</a> will also rollout Enhanced Safe Browsing feature for <a href="https://www.gizmochina.com/tag/android">Android</a> users in which users will be able to choose to be proactively protected against phishing, malware, and other dangerous sites by sharing real-time data with the company&#8217;s Safe Browsing service.</p>
